# Break-Glass: Catalog Cache Invalidation

Scope: the Pinrow product catalog at Veldstone Retail. If stale prices persist after a purge and the Hollowmere invalidation queue is wedged, use break-glass to flush the edge tier directly. Contractors: get verbal sign-off from the catalog lead first. Steps: open the Hollowmere admin shell, select emergency-flush, confirm the tenant, and run it once — repeated flushes thrash the origin. Access is logged and expires after 20 minutes. Unseal the admin shell with the passphrase below.

recovery phrase for kahop-tajog: istix-casvan

Flagging for the release manager: the Quillcheck documentation linter now enforces heading depth and link freshness across the Merrivale handbook repos. These thresholds were agreed with the docs guild and should ship frozen for the 4.2 cut; loosening them mid-release invalidates the baseline report. The constants we will release with are shown below.

limits module of fajog-tawig:
RATE_LIMITS = {
    "druwyn": 2,
    "quenael": 10,
    "wenix": 2,
    "druael": 2,
}

## Further reading

If you're reviewing changes to the Crumplefall crash-report pipeline, skim the ingestion notes first — symbolication order matters more than you'd think, and the dedupe hashing has bitten reviewers before. The retention rules are also a frequent gotcha. Architecture diagrams, the dedupe spec, and past review checklists are all gathered on the internal docs page below.

wiki page, tahaf-tajog: https://jira.ordindyn.corp/pipeline

// Notes for the weekly eng sync re: Gallerywhisper, our museum audio-guide app.
// This constant sets the prefetch radius for exhibit audio clips. At the
// Hollen Pavilion pilot we learned visitors walk faster than our original
// estimate, so clips were buffering mid-stride. Bumping this to three rooms
// ahead fixed it, at a modest bandwidth cost. Don't lower it without testing
// on the slow gallery wifi first — seriously, it's painful. The trace token
// from the pilot build that validated this number is appended just below.

trace token, kahap-bagaf: htk4_8458